Give reason for the following:
Concentrated sulphuric acid should not be added to oxalic acid or formic acid in the open laboratory.
Advertisements
उत्तर
Concentrated sulphuric acid should not be added to oxalic acid or formic acid as it removes water and forms carbon monoxide. Carbon monoxide is harmful for health so this addition must be done in an open laboratory.
